The Technical Writing Fundamentals course is available to help both GitLab and community contributors write and edit documentation for the product. This course provides direction on grammar and topic design.
This class is not required to contribute to docs.gitlab.com. Everybody can contribute!
You can review the training materials on this page, or you can take the course in Level Up to earn a badge (requires a Level Up account).
The Technical Writing Fundamentals course consists of the following sections to be completed in order.
Complete the pre-class exercises from this excellent Google training. You can take the associated Google class if you like, but the GitLab Technical Writing Fundamentals sessions 1-4 cover the information that is relevant for GitLab.
Start with the pre-class work ~12 short sessions.
Use the slide deck to follow along with the recorded training sessions.
Provides an introduction, the audience for the documentation, a brief recap of pre-class work, and the first grammar and style requirements.
Reviews additional grammar and style requirements.
Reviews even more grammar and style requirements and linting.
Reviews topic types: concepts, tasks, references, troubleshooting (CTRT).
While we emphasize asynchronous training, in-person training for GitLab team members is available on a limited basis. Contact Susan Tacker (@susantacker
in Slack) to schedule training sessions.